The naira appreciated to N1,522 against the United States dollar in the Nigerian Foreign Exchange Market (NFEM) on Wednesday, September 3, 2025.
However, the naira depreciated to N1,540 against the dollar in the parallel market on Wednesday, from N1,537 per dollar recorded on Tuesday.

Data published by the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) showed that the exchange rate for the nation’s currency fell to N1,522 per dollar from N1,525.45 per dollar on Tuesday, indicating N3.45 appreciation for the local currency.
The margin between the parallel market and NFEM rate widened to N18 per dollar from N11.55 per dollar recorded on Tuesday.
